How Marin County Public Defender: Unsung Heroes of Justice Actually Works

At its core, the Marin County Public Defender office provides legal counsel to individuals who cannot afford private attorneys. When someone is charged with a crime and lacks the financial means to hire a lawyer, a public defender is appointed by the court. These professionals investigate cases, gather evidence, and negotiate on behalf of their clients. For example, they might challenge evidence procedures or explore alternative sentencing options. Their goal is to ensure that every person receives a fair trial, regardless of economic status. This system is a cornerstone of the legal framework designed to protect individual rights.

Does working with a public defender mean I will receive less support than someone who can afford a private attorney?

Many people wonder about the quality of representation provided by public defender offices. In reality, public defenders are licensed attorneys bound by the same ethical standards as private lawyers. They often manage substantial caseloads but are dedicated to advocating for their clients’ best interests. The support offered includes case review, plea negotiations, and trial preparation. While resources may vary, the commitment to due process remains consistent across the system. Understanding this can help alleviate concerns about unequal legal protection.

How can I find information about services in my area if I need a public defender?

If you are looking for information regarding public defense resources, contacting your local court clerk is a practical first step. They can direct you to the public defender’s office in your jurisdiction. Additionally, many states maintain online directories that explain eligibility requirements and the application process. Being prepared with details about your charges and financial situation can streamline the appointment process. Knowledge of these steps empowers individuals to seek help confidently and efficiently.

Things People Often Misunderstand

A common myth is that public defenders are less qualified than private attorneys. This is not accurate, as public defenders undergo the same rigorous training and licensing processes. Another misunderstanding is that their role is simply to plead guilty on behalf of their clients. In truth, they actively work to build the strongest possible defense, which may include going to trial when appropriate. Some also assume that using a public defender carries a stigma, but it is simply a component of the justice system designed to uphold rights. Correcting these misconceptions fosters a more informed public perspective.
